Cairo, Egypt – Badr Abdel Aty, Minister of Foreign Affairs, Immigration, and Egyptian Expatriates Affairs, held a phone call with Mossad Boulos, Senior Advisor to the US President for Arab and Middle East Affairs and Senior Advisor for African Affairs. The call was to discuss developments in both Sudan and Libya.

Ambassador Tamim Khalaf, the official spokesperson for the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, said that during the call, the two sides emphasized the importance of reaching an immediate and permanent ceasefire in Sudan. They also emphasized the need to preserve Sudan’s unity, territorial integrity, and national institutions, in order to safeguard the resources of the Sudanese people and fulfill their aspirations for security and stability.

The official spokesperson added that the two sides discussed the latest developments in the Libyan crisis and stressed the importance of unifying Libyan institutions in preparation for legislative and presidential elections, thus fulfilling the Libyan people’s aspirations for stability and development.
